Iranian attacks have struck consulates, US bases, and energy facilities located on the Arabian Peninsula. The Gulf monarchies are now confronted with a critical decision. They must choose whether to persist in a policy of waiting and observation. Or to actively become parties to the escalating war themselves. This development places the Gulf states at a pivotal crossroads amid the ongoing Middle East escalation.
